About Abdullah Khalili

Abdullah Khalili is a scholar working on Computer Networks and Communications, Control and Systems Engineering and Instrumentation, having authored 21 papers that have together received 275 indexed citations. Recurring topics across this work include Smart Grid Security and Resilience (9 papers), Network Security and Intrusion Detection (9 papers) and Anomaly Detection Techniques and Applications (3 papers). The work is most often cited by research in Control and Systems Engineering (123 citations), Computer Networks and Communications (110 citations) and Signal Processing (28 citations). Abdullah Khalili has collaborated with scholars based in Iran, United Kingdom and Türkiye. Frequent co-authors include Ashkan Sami, İstemihan Genç, Charalambos Konstantinou, Abdel‐Hamid Soliman, Md Asaduzzaman, Alison Griffiths, Maryam Dehghani, Shahram Golzari, Navid Vafamand and Tomislav Dragičević. Their work appears in journals such as IEEE Transactions on Industrial Electronics, IEEE Access and Electronics Letters.
